FLP, NFP, PA, SODELPA, Unity Fiji and We Unite Fiji confirm their participation for the Youth Debate on fijivillage Straight Talk With Vijay Narayan at 7pm tonight

FijiFirst yet to confirm

By fijivillage
06/12/2022

The voices of the younger generation is critical in the 2022 general elections, as 350,930 people registered to vote are between the age of 18 to 40 years.

Based on the importance of this, a special fijivillage Straight Talk with Vijay Narayan will take place with youth candidates of political parties at 7pm tonight.

Invitations were sent to the concerned parties from early November and we have continued to follow up to get the confirmations.

Fiji Labour Party youth candidate Milika Nasilivata, National Federation Party candidate Apenisa Vatuniveivuke, People’s Alliance youth candidate Bulou Gavidi, SODELPA’s Koroi Tikoilomaloma, Unity Fiji’s Peni Matanisiga and We Unite Fiji youth candidate, Nitish Sharma have confirmed their participation, and will appear on Straight Talk at 7pm tonight.

We are still awaiting a confirmation from FijiFirst General Secretary, Aiyaz Sayed-Khaiyum on the participation of a FijiFirst youth candidate.
